A few days have passed now and another bit done. I have painted the baseboard around the brewery ready to lay the wagon sidings and “grass” and ballast.
The pictures

 below shows the grass being laid in stages for the benefit of the camera. But I think that large areas would benefit from a “do it in one go” policy
Spreading the glue with a paint brush ensures an even and consistent base for the grass

Don’t worry about the white glue showing through as it dries to transparent and oly the green will be left.
